What will you do?   

  • Lead key roles in priority CS Roadmap programs, including process analysis, pilot program development, and control plan creation.
  • Collaborate across teams, including Experience Architects, Segment Managers, Service Improvement Managers, and Regional Operations Managers, to drive Continuous Improvement initiatives. These projects focus on enhancing specific CS business processes for improved operational efficiency and customer experience.
  • Partner with Shared Services, Policy, and Support Product teams to assess process impacts and design changes for high-priority initiatives as part of Change Management.
  • Collaborate with CS Analytics to establish process measurement systems, analyze data, and drive decision-making. Utilize data analytics tools to support process improvements.
  • Deliver successful improvement projects with measurable positive impacts and ensure a smooth transition to operations for sustained results, including feature launches.

Skills Required:

  • 5+ years of proven experience in leading and supporting cross-functional project teams for implementing operational changes.
  • Bachelor’s degree in industrial engineering or a similar field
  • Strong knowledge and application of Lean Six Sigma methodology for process improvement projects
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ills to collect and analyze data for identifying root causes of problems.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ills to effectively communicate progress and opportunities to senior leadership and stakeholders.
